2023 Monitor Top Women in Equipment Finance: Katy Chan, Northteq

Katy Chan, Director of Professional Services, Northteq — Project Management Professional Certification (PMP)

Katy Chan joined Northteq in 2022 and currently serves as the director of professional services, focused on delivering quality service and value-add solutions to clients.

Chan started her career in technology as a project manager. She was in the field for 15 years working for various companies in the financial services and financial technology industries. During this time, Chan garnered a reputation for being a “fixer;” if a project was over budget or a client was unhappy, Chan would step in.

She attributes her success in managing difficult situations to following a “people-first” approach: before making a plan, Chan will take the time to listen to the client’s concerns and get feedback from the team on where things went wrong.

“I’m a strong believer that people want to feel heard and that they can be part of the solution,” Chan says. “By taking the time to listen to client stories and asking questions, you can uncover the root cause, which is critical to devising a new actionable plan. Once you have a plan, you create the right team to execute.”

Chan recognizes that a project manager is only as strong as the project team. Over the years, Chan has honed her skills in building and leading high performant project teams. She does this by fostering a safe and collaborative work environment. She takes the time to get to know everyone she works with by learning the people behind the name and title. “It’s very powerful to be able to foster a team culture where everyone feels a deep sense of belonging.” Chan says.

Since transitioning into a leadership role at Northteq, Chan has shifted the “people-first” approach that worked in her projects into building out her team and being an effective people manager. She gives agency to the people that report to her by listening to their concerns, asking the right questions and helping them identify and come up with the solutions to their root problems.

At the beginning of 2023, Northteq established a goal of reducing implementation times by 50%, which it achieved by Q3. Not resting on their laurels, Chan saw an opportunity to ride this momentum further and push her team to reduce implementation times by another 15% by the end of 2023.

Chan has coined this as Northteq’s ‘NextGen implementation.’ During Northteq’s company onsite, she gathered her services team to brainstorm how to achieve this goal. Fast forward two weeks, the team was already piloting their improvements with a new client.

“Katy listens. She takes active listening to new heights, asks questions and challenges until she truly understands the problem,” Lara Tolland, chief operating officer of Northteq, says. “Then she drives solutions to the problem, focusing on the root cause she identified. This year, Katy was able to lead Northteq towards one of our ambitious goals of reducing our LOS implementation hours by 50%. Katy is highly focused on delivering to our clients, and she’s unquestionably hit the mark with her approach and accomplishments this year.”
